| hayatepilot:
--- Quote from: viperidae on April 20, 2018, 06:39:47 am ---With 3 coils per phase you'd probably want 12 magnets --- End quote --- This. If you have the same number of magnets as coils, the motor will not work. You want a 9N12P Motor: http://www.bavaria-direct.co.za/scheme/common/ Winding Scheme Calculator: http://www.bavaria-direct.co.za/scheme/calculator/ This will work too if the coils are on the outside and the magnets inside.
